Source: China Chemical Industry News. According to reports from Sinochem News Network, on May 9, Henan Jindadi Chemical Co., Ltd. announced that on May 8, the two Jinhua furnace units in its newly built ammonia synthesis plant were able to produce over 1,800 tons of ammonia per day, achieving 100% of their planned production capacity. The company states that the two Jinhua furnace 3.0 models generate 145 tons per hour of high-pressure steam at 7.0 MPa as a by-product of the gasification process; the steam produced per ton of ammonia is over 1.94 tons. The entire plant produces approximately 4.6 tons of steam per ton of ammonia, with an electricity consumption of 240 kWh per ton of ammonia, demonstrating significant energy-saving effects. This marks the successful industrial application of the world’s first large-scale water-cooled wall direct-connected waste boiler gasification technology with a pressure of 6.5 MPa and a daily coal feeding capacity of 1,500 tons (Jinhua Furnace 3.0). Li Jianxin, an expert in coal chemical engineering and the person in charge of the Jindadi ammonia synthesis project, told reporters that the full utilization of waste heat and wastewater has always been a goal pursued in the development of coal gasification in China. The large-scale Jinhua furnace generates 1.63 tons of steam for every 3 tons of ammonia produced, which helps to process a large amount of industrial wastewater. This not only brings significant economic, environmental, and ecological benefits to Jindadi, but also provides an innovative and effective technology that contributes to the upgrading of traditional industries and the development of modern coal chemical industry in China.
